Product Description
The PNY XLR8 SSD is a long lasting, shock proof storage drive specifically designed for long term photo/video storage, and home usage such as web browsing, emails, faster operating system and program launching. These drives feature a 2.5" SATA III, 6Gbps interface, support 256-bit AES encryption and are powered by SandForce 2281 controllers, offering up to 550MB/s seq. read, 520MB/s seq. write speeds, and 85,000 random read/write IOPS - specs that translate to storage that drastically improves your system's performance and will keep your content stored for a long time.

Picked this SSD up for my new desktop build as it was a great deal. 160 dollars at this time (2/22/2013).Popped it into my machine, installed Windows 7, did all my updates, and ran some benchmarks. Sequential Read speed is about 490MB and Write was 290 or so. I'm a little disappointed in the write speeds as it's rated over 500 and it performs worse than the Samsung 830 that I have in my laptop. The Samsung 830 is rated lower for the speeds yet performs better in the actual benchmarks Overall though, I don't think I'll notice the difference and am happy with it. Time will tell if that stays the same.I also got the 2 extra years of warranty for a total of 5 upon registration. I'm giving it 4/5 as the write speeds are well off what the maximum claim is.
